- 博客(21)
- 资源 (5)
- 收藏
- 关注

原创 Android开发常用片段
拨打电话public static void call(Context context, String phoneNumber) { context.startActivity(newIntent(Intent.ACTION_CALL, Uri.parse("tel:"+ phoneNumber))); }跳转至拨号界面public static voi
2016-12-14 10:11:33
615
原创 Intellij IDEA找回Run Dashboard
Intellij IDEA创建了Maven项目之后运行项目没有显示Run Dashboard,SpringBoot是这样显示,还是比较炫的。在项目.idea/workspace.xml 文件中找到,RunDashboard节点添加一下配置重新编译运行即可: <component name="RunDashboard"> <option name="confi...
2018-05-02 14:03:43
1646
原创 Intellij IDEA使用Maven Helper插件Tomcat Plugin运行web项目
由于以前每次部署项目都需要安装Tomcat然后再配置,感觉比较麻烦,以下使用tomcat插件配置运行实现。1.安装Maven Helper插件,装完重启IDE2.创建Maven项目,并添加Tomcat插件创建完成之后,更改pom.xml文件<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apa...
2018-05-02 13:40:50
1211
原创 org.apache.struts2.convention.DefaultClassFinder - Unable to read class
[ERROR] 2018-02-22 10:30:32,745 org.apache.struts2.convention.DefaultClassFinder - Unable to read class [com.cock.bos.web.action.base.BaseAction]java.lang.IncompatibleClassChangeError: class org.apac...
2018-02-22 10:55:31
8103
原创 Android移动测试
一.移动测试效果简单展示使用Python脚本实现移动测试功能,先看效果:接下来就是环境的配置了二.环境配置2.1 搭建Node.js环境1、到官网下载node.js安装node.js版本不宜过高,选择稳定使用较多的即可,否则会报 error: uncaughtException: Cannot find module 'internal/fs'错
2017-07-21 16:03:22
2599
原创 使用rxjava2实现界面跳转
使用rxjava2实现从欢迎界面跳转到主界面 现在看到有许多项目都使用了rxjava2,那我就以简单的从欢迎界面跳转到主界面为例: 以前一般都是欢迎界面的onCreate方法中,通过Handle开启一个子线程,设置延迟时间打开主界面。比如: new Handler().postDelayed(new Runnable() { @Override
2017-06-06 16:49:18
1744
原创 AndroidStudio创建Compile依赖
我们在AndroidStudio中经常使用compile的方式来导入第三方代码,比如dependencies { compile fileTree(dir: 'libs', include: ['*.jar']) androidTestCompile('com.android.support.test.espresso:espresso-core:2.2.2', {
2017-05-24 18:21:10
3666
转载 Java中try-catch-finally-return的执行顺序
转载自:http://qing0991.blog.51cto.com/1640542/1387200
2017-05-22 23:45:16
470
原创 阿里云推送ReactNative简单集成
阿里云推送ReactNative简单集成1.创建ReactNative项目创建项目完成可以省略这一步,如果初次接触,参考ReactNative中文网创建项目教程。2.移动推送Android接入SDK移动推送的SDK接入方式和原生接入大体相同,接入参考:移动推送SDK指南。3.创建PushMoudle模块新建PushMoudle类继承ReactContextBaseJavaModule,请参考以下代码
2017-05-17 18:05:37
2090
1
原创 Android集成阿里云消息推送的方法步骤
一 创建App应用1.1 在控制台发(https://mhub.console.aliyun.com)的App列表页,点击页面产品列表中“添加产品”的图标即可创建一个新的产品(产品是一个集合的概念,产品下包含iOS应用、Android应用)。然后点击刚创建的产品,点击“添加应用”的图标即可添加Android或者iOS应用(目前只能创建分端应用了,个人感觉还是不分端的好)。1.2 输入APP基本信息...
2017-03-20 12:05:21
26361
7
原创 微信小程序个人理解
微信小程序在文章的结尾会给出一些视频和项目源码供大家交流学习 好了接下来就要进入微信小程序的学习阶段了, 微信小程序并不难, 但是由于我们并没有接触过前端的开发, 所以可能不太好理解, 练习一个小案例, 会有更深的印象。在开始之前, 有一点需要强调, 虽然微信小程序使用了大量的前端开发的技术, 但是微信小程序是原生的, 并且这些代码无法在浏览器中执行。环境1
2017-01-11 20:56:31
863
转载 Dialog、Toast、Snackbar的区别和使用
转载出处:http://blog.youkuaiyun.com/guolin_blog/article/details/51336415 Dialog和Toast所有人肯定都不会陌生的,这个我们平时用的实在是太多了。而Snackbar是Design Support库中提供的新控件,有些朋友可能已经用过了,有些朋友可能还没去了解。但是你真的知道什么时候应该使用Dialog,什么时候应该使用T
2017-01-05 14:43:27
1374
原创 关于js变量两个面试题
经典面试题f1();console.log(c);console.log(b);console.log(a);function f1(){ var a = b = c = 9; console.log(c); console.log(b); console.log(a); }答案:9 9 9 9 9 undefined。当调用函数f
2016-12-30 09:41:49
735
原创 前端面试知识点锦集(HTML部分)——附答案
目录一、HTML部分1、浏览器页面有哪三层构成,分别是什么?作用是什么?2、HTML5的优点与缺点3、Doctype作用? 严格模式与混杂模式如何区分?它们有何意义?4、HTML5有哪些新特性、移除了哪些元素?5、你做的网页在哪些流览器测试过?这些浏览器的内核分别是什么?6、每个HTML文件里开头都有个很重要的东西,Doctype,知道这是干什么的吗?7、Doctype的作用 ?
2016-12-21 13:05:49
659
原创 css中解决浮动DIV撑开父层高度的问题
1) 加高法:浮动的元素,只能被有高度的盒子关住。 也就是说,如果盒子内部有浮动,这个盒子有高,那么妥妥的,浮动不会互相影响。但是,工作上,我们绝对不会给所有的盒子加高度,这是因为麻烦,并且不能适应页面的快速变化。1 →设置height2 3 4
2016-12-14 10:31:33
4313
原创 视差效果实现
视差效果实现效果图1.先上效果图 源码当前使用的ReycleView当然也有使用listview版本的使用ReycleView版本 使用ListView版本 首先是自定义的两个view代码如下:ParallaxRecycleViewpackage com.cock.parallaxrecyclerview.view;import android
2016-12-06 10:19:42
528
原创 Java基础总结
面向对象面向对象是一种思想,是基于面向过程而言的,就是说面向对象是将功能等通过对象来实现,将功能封装进对象之中,让对象去实现具体的细节;这种思想是将数据作为第一位,而方法或者说是算法作为其次,这是对数据一种优化,操作起来更加的方便,简化了过程。面向对象有三大特征:封装性、继承性、多态性,其中封装性指的是隐藏了对象的属性和实现细节,仅对外提供公共的访问方式,这样就隔离了具体的变化,便于使用,
2016-11-11 15:08:32
225
原创 联系人快速索引
#联系人快速索引###MainActivity主要代码public class MainActivity extends AppCompatActivity { @InjectView(R.id.lv_contacts) ListView lvContacts; @InjectView(R.id.quick_index_bar) QuickIndexB
2016-10-13 16:32:24
530
Maven archetype-catalog.xml
2018-01-04
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人